It’s a means of displaying inventory to appear “well stocked” without actually increasing inventory cost. Also a means, in lay away programs, to motivate guys to pay off, since other folks are watching their tags, not being paid off... For new items, it’s a means to continue to display something without increasing inventory cost and ordering a replacement - but knowing another could be available in 2 days.
Really common practice for SOT’s - as long as the product won’t get damaged, it’s a great opportunity to display held inventory and propagate further sales without increasing inventory costs, while the future owner’s application is processed.
